How much do professional leasing consultant j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 25, 2026, the average hourly pay for professional leasing consultant in the United States is $17.59,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.87 and $18.75 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

How much do leasing agents make?

Leasing agents typically earn an average annual salary of around $40,000 to $50,000, with additional commissions or bonuses based on leasing performance. Compensation can vary depending on experience, location, and the property management company's size and policies.

Are leasing consultants in high demand?

Leasing consultants are in steady demand due to ongoing growth in the rental housing market and the need for property management professionals. Strong communication skills and knowledge of leasing software can improve job prospects, especially in competitive markets.

Is leasing consultant a good career?

A leasing consultant is a customer service-focused role that involves showing properties, explaining lease terms, and managing tenant inquiries. It can offer opportunities for commission-based income, flexible schedules, and career advancement in property management, but may also require strong communication skills and the ability to handle difficult situations.

How much commission does a leasing consultant make?

A leasing consultant typically earns a commission that ranges from 50% to 100% of the first month's rent for each lease they secure. Some employers also offer bonuses or incentives based on leasing targets, and commissions are often paid out monthly or upon lease signing. Total earnings can vary depending on location, experience, and the property's commission structure.

What are professional leasing consultants?

Professional leasing consultants are specialists who assist property owners and management companies in renting out residential or commercial spaces. Their primary responsibilities include marketing available properties, showing units to prospective tenants, processing rental applications, and handling lease agreements. They also address tenant concerns, ensure compliance with relevant laws and regulations, and strive to maximize occupancy rates. Effective leasing consultants possess strong communication, sales, and customer service skills.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Professional Leasing Consultant,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Professional Leasing Consultant, you need strong sales abilities, knowledge of fair housing laws, and typically a high school diploma or equivalent, with some employers preferring property management certifications. Familiarity with property management software such as Yardi or AppFolio and CRM tools is often required. Exceptional interpersonal, negotiation, and customer service skills help build rapport with prospective tenants and resolve issues effectively. These skills and qualifications are vital to attract and retain tenants, ensure legal compliance, and contribute to the property's financial success.

What are some typical challenges faced by Professional Leasing Consultants during the busy rental season, and how can they be managed?

During peak rental seasons, Professional Leasing Consultants often face increased workloads, tight timelines, and higher competition among properties. Managing a high volume of prospective tenants, scheduling multiple property tours, and quickly processing applications can be challenging. Staying organized, maintaining clear communication with both applicants and property management teams, and utilizing property management software are key strategies to handle these busy periods effectively. Successful consultants also prioritize follow-ups and maintain a positive attitude to ensure excellent customer service even under pressure.

Job description

Job Title: Leasing Consultant (Bilingual Preferred)
Location: Fort Myers, FL
Pay: Competitive Pay | Weekly Pay

Now Hiring: Leasing Consultant

Certified Apartment Staffing is currently hiring Leasing Consultants for apartment communities in Fort Myers, FL. We're looking for energetic, customer-focused individuals who enjoy working with people and thrive in a fast-paced environment.

If you have apartment leasing experience and a passion for providing exceptional customer service, we encourage you to apply. Bilingual candidates (English/Spanish) are strongly preferred.

Job Description

As a Leasing Consultant, you will be the first point of contact for prospective residents. Your primary responsibilities will include leasing apartment homes, providing outstanding customer service, assisting current residents, and helping the property maintain high occupancy levels.

Responsibilities:

  • Welcome prospective residents and provide professional community tours.
  • Answer phone calls, emails, and online leasing inquiries.
  • Process rental applications, lease agreements, and move-in paperwork.
  • Explain lease terms, community amenities, and rental policies.
  • Assist with lease renewals and resident retention.
  • Build strong relationships with current and prospective residents.
  • Maintain an organized and professional leasing office.
  • Follow up with prospects to convert leads into leases.
  • Assist with marketing and community outreach initiatives.
  • Support the property management team with administrative duties as needed.

Requirements:

  • Previous apartment leasing experience preferred.
  • Bilingual (English/Spanish) is strongly preferred.
  • Excellent customer service, communication, and sales skills.
  • Professional appearance and positive attitude.
  • Basic computer skills; experience with Yardi, Entrata, ResMan, OneSite, or similar property management software is a plus.
  • Reliable transportation.
  • Ability to work weekends as needed.
  • Must be able to pass a criminal background check.
